摘要
Taking the videophone for example, this study developed a process and method of product form perception based on customer preferences. This study proposed the a process of product form perception evaluation scale which includes 17 appraisal words and 10 representative pictures by questionnaires, multidimensional scaling, and cluster analysis method. Then it established the relationship model between consumer preference and image words using multiple regression analysis and the relationship model between consumer preference and appearance design variables using conjoint analysis. These two models will support videophone product form designers during the design process and can also indicate other products designers with methods of meeting consumers' emotional demands.
